What Does the Ford F-150 Check Engine Light Mean?
The check engine light, often called the Malfunction Indicator Lamp (MIL), is part of the truck's onboard diagnostic system.
Modern Ford F-150 models continuously monitor engine performance, emissions systems, fuel delivery, ignition timing, and numerous sensors. When the truck's computer detects a problem outside normal operating parameters, it stores a diagnostic trouble code (DTC) and illuminates the check engine light.
Think of the light as the truck's way of saying:
"Something isn't quite right. Please investigate."
The light itself does not identify the exact issue. Instead, it alerts us that the vehicle requires attention.
Solid vs Flashing Check Engine Light
Not all check engine lights are equally serious.
Solid Check Engine Light
A steady check engine light usually indicates a non-emergency issue.
Examples include:
- Loose gas cap
- Faulty oxygen sensor
- Evaporative emissions leak
- Minor sensor malfunction
In many cases, we can continue driving while scheduling diagnostics.
Flashing Check Engine Light
A flashing check engine light is much more serious.
This typically indicates a severe engine misfire that could damage the catalytic converter.
If the light is flashing:
- Reduce speed immediately
- Avoid heavy acceleration
- Stop driving when safe
- Arrange inspection as soon as possible
Ignoring a flashing light can turn a small repair into a very expensive one.
Most Common Ford F-150 Check Engine Light Causes
The F-150 has evolved significantly over the years, but certain issues appear more frequently than others.
Loose or Faulty Gas Cap
Surprisingly, one of the most common causes is a loose fuel cap.
The emissions system relies on maintaining proper pressure inside the fuel system. If the gas cap is not sealed correctly, the computer may detect a leak.
Symptoms include:
- Check engine light only
- No performance changes
- No unusual sounds
Fortunately, this is often the easiest fix.
Faulty Oxygen Sensor
Oxygen sensors measure exhaust gases and help the engine maintain the proper air-fuel ratio.
When an oxygen sensor fails, the engine may:
- Use more fuel
- Produce higher emissions
- Run less efficiently
Replacing a faulty sensor is typically straightforward and helps restore fuel economy.
Bad Spark Plugs or Ignition Coils
Spark plugs ignite the fuel-air mixture inside the engine.
When plugs or ignition coils wear out, misfires can occur.
Common signs include:
- Rough idle
- Engine hesitation
- Reduced power
- Poor fuel economy
The EcoBoost engines found in many F-150 models can be particularly sensitive to ignition system issues.
EcoBoost-Specific Check Engine Light Problems
Ford's EcoBoost engines combine turbocharging and direct injection to deliver excellent power and efficiency.
However, these advanced systems can also trigger unique diagnostic codes.
Turbocharger Issues
Turbochargers increase engine power by forcing additional air into the combustion chamber.
Potential problems include:
- Wastegate failure
- Boost leaks
- Damaged turbo components
- Faulty boost pressure sensors
When turbo issues occur, the check engine light often appears alongside reduced power.
Carbon Build-Up
Direct-injection engines can develop carbon deposits on intake valves over time.
Excessive carbon accumulation may cause:
- Rough idle
- Misfires
- Reduced performance
- Check engine light activation
Periodic maintenance can help minimize these deposits.
Boost Pressure Leaks
EcoBoost engines depend on pressurized air pathways.
Leaks in hoses, intercoolers, or connectors may trigger codes related to insufficient boost pressure.
The truck may feel sluggish or less responsive during acceleration.
Mass Air Flow Sensor Problems
The Mass Air Flow (MAF) sensor measures the amount of air entering the engine.
The computer uses this information to determine fuel delivery.
When the sensor becomes dirty or fails:
- Fuel economy drops
- Engine performance suffers
- Idle quality declines
- Check engine light appears
In some cases, cleaning the sensor may solve the issue.
Signs of a Bad MAF Sensor
Watch for:
- Stalling
- Hesitation
- Hard starting
- Surging acceleration
These symptoms often accompany specific airflow-related trouble codes.
Catalytic Converter Failure
The catalytic converter reduces harmful emissions.
A failing converter can trigger the check engine light while causing:
- Reduced engine power
- Sulfur-like odors
- Poor acceleration
- Increased fuel consumption
Because catalytic converters are expensive, addressing misfires and sensor issues early helps prevent converter damage.
Fuel System Problems
The fuel system is another common source of check engine warnings.
Fuel Injector Issues
Fuel injectors deliver precise amounts of fuel into the engine.
When injectors become clogged or malfunction:
- Misfires occur
- Idle quality deteriorates
- Performance decreases
Fuel Pump Problems
A weak fuel pump can struggle to provide adequate fuel pressure.
Common symptoms include:
- Hard starts
- Loss of power
- Stalling
- Check engine light activation
Ford F-150 Emissions System Problems
Modern trucks contain sophisticated emissions systems designed to reduce pollution.
EVAP System Leaks
The Evaporative Emission Control System captures fuel vapors before they escape into the atmosphere.
Leaks may result from:
- Cracked hoses
- Faulty purge valves
- Damaged fuel caps
EVAP faults are extremely common causes of check engine lights.
EGR Valve Malfunctions
The Exhaust Gas Recirculation system helps reduce combustion temperatures.
A malfunctioning EGR valve can create:
- Rough running
- Engine knocking
- Reduced efficiency
Check Engine Light and Reduced Power Mode
Sometimes the F-150 enters a protective operating mode known as limp mode.
This occurs when the computer believes continued normal operation could damage the engine or transmission.
Symptoms include:
- Limited acceleration
- Reduced engine power
- Restricted RPM range
The truck intentionally sacrifices performance to protect critical components.
Why Limp Mode Happens
Potential triggers include:
- Severe sensor failures
- Turbocharger faults
- Transmission problems
- Major engine misfires
Professional diagnosis is strongly recommended.
Can You Drive an F-150 With the Check Engine Light On?
The answer depends on the circumstances.
Usually Safe to Drive
If:
- The light is steady
- Performance feels normal
- No unusual noises exist
Short-term driving is generally acceptable.
Stop Driving Immediately
If:
- The light flashes
- The engine shakes violently
- Smoke appears
- Significant power loss occurs
Continuing to drive may cause severe damage.
How to Read Ford F-150 Check Engine Codes
Every diagnostic event generates a trouble code.
Examples include:
- P0171 – System Too Lean
- P0300 – Random Misfire
- P0420 – Catalytic Converter Efficiency Below Threshold
- P0101 – Mass Air Flow Sensor Performance
Using an OBD-II Scanner
An OBD-II scanner plugs into the diagnostic port beneath the dashboard.
Benefits include:
- Fast diagnosis
- Code retrieval
- Clearing stored codes
- Monitoring live engine data
Many affordable scanners provide valuable information for DIY troubleshooting.
Ford F-150 Check Engine Light Reset Procedure
Many owners wonder if they can simply reset the light.
Technically, yes—but that doesn't fix the problem.
Method 1: OBD-II Scanner
The safest method is using a scanner to clear codes after repairs are completed.
Method 2: Battery Disconnect
Some owners disconnect the battery for several minutes.
However:
- Codes may return
- Radio settings may reset
- Underlying issues remain
Clearing the light without fixing the cause is like covering a smoke alarm instead of extinguishing the fire.
How Much Does It Cost to Fix a Ford F-150 Check Engine Light?
Repair costs vary dramatically depending on the root cause.
Minor Repairs
- Gas cap replacement: $20–$60
- Sensor cleaning: $0–$100
- Air filter replacement: $20–$80
Moderate Repairs
- Oxygen sensor replacement: $150–$500
- Ignition coils: $100–$600
- Spark plugs: $150–$450
Major Repairs
- Catalytic converter: $1,000–$3,500+
- Turbocharger replacement: $1,500–$4,000+
- Fuel system repairs: $500–$2,500+
The sooner a problem is diagnosed, the lower the likelihood of costly secondary damage.

1. Why is my Ford F-150 check engine light on but the truck runs fine?
A steady check engine light often indicates minor issues such as a loose gas cap, emissions fault, or sensor malfunction that may not immediately affect performance.
2. Can a bad battery cause a check engine light on an F-150?
Yes. Low voltage conditions can sometimes trigger sensor-related codes and warning lights.
3. How long can I drive with the check engine light on?
If the light is steady and the truck runs normally, short-term driving is usually acceptable. A flashing light requires immediate attention.
4. Will the check engine light reset itself?
In some cases, the light may turn off after multiple successful drive cycles if the issue is resolved. However, stored codes often remain in memory.
5. Is it expensive to diagnose a Ford F-150 check engine light?
Diagnostic fees typically range from $50 to $200, depending on location and shop rates. Identifying the problem early often reduces overall repair costs.
